Take on a short-term contract role with consistent weekday hours as a Gas Engineer, carrying out servicing work across domestic properties in Birmingham. This is a great opportunity to join a well-established social housing contractor and deliver essential heating services to homes that need it most.
You will be working in occupied properties, supported by a reliable team with a steady flow of work.
